Output 3d26da37314ef16ecf1b18de4cffd8abb2765439d9b36cba05da7483646912cb:2

value
344983439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cea9bf7e4413bd74299e0eca1b0f594bd594da3 OP_EQUALVERIFY OP_CHECKSIG
address
181hQWuhTiPYVmKfqym1mXYiHm5PVoJiLZ
transaction
3d26da37314ef16ecf1b18de4cffd8abb2765439d9b36cba05da7483646912cb
spent
true